quantifier


Concise Oxford English Dictionary © 2008 Oxford University Press:
quantifier/ˈkwɒntɪfʌɪə(r)/
noun
  • 1 Logic an expression (e.g. some) that indicates the scope of a term to which it is attached.
  • 2 Grammar a determiner or pronoun indicative of quantity (e.g. all).
